The Great and the Grand ~ Benjamin Fox

description

“It is an uncommonly good day. Sunrise brings The New from slumber. Meanwhile, The Old prepares for visitors.”

This beautifully illustrated book showcases a grandchild meeting their grandfather.

We get glimpses into their lives – how each one interprets their world, and the importance of their perspectives.

“The New sees The Old for the first time and smiles.
The Old holds The New for the first time and cries.”

Whew. This one was wonderful.

What really stood out to myself is just how much I could I could see myself in this story. As I read on, so many moments connected me and my own little baby to the actions of the characters.

I don’t think I truly have words for how it felt to see my own dad hold his grandchild for the first time, but this book comes pretty darn close.

What really stuck out to me for this book is just how much emotion the author is able to showcase with just a few words and an illustration.

Seriously, I started to lose it with “The Old is learning to let go” and the tears were flowing the moment The Old and The New were met.

I really think that’s a sign of an incredible picture book – to elicit such a reaction in a reader with only a handful of sentences. It was beautiful.

And the illustrations – I cannot resist talking up these pictures. They were incredibly well-done, far beyond what I’d expect for a typical picture book. Icing on the cake! Cherry on the sundae. Sprinkles on the cookie!

This is going to be a treasured story for our family.
